I am the same boat as you! I have a Gateway 466E-DX2 with 32MB running NT. I have Adaptec 1742A (not terminated), Seagate 1GB Hard Disk (terminated – internal – SCSI 0), Pioneer DRM-600 CD-ROM (terminated – external – SCSI 2), and HP34580A Tape Drive (not terminated – external – SCSI 3). When I try do do a backup, after 6 to 8 files, I get a tape error. The error log says that the SCSI controller had a time-out error. No one has yet to provide a theory as to why this is happening.
